Layer::AddMeasurementRectCommand Class Reference

#include <Layer.h>

Inheritance diagram for Layer::AddMeasurementRectCommand:
Inheritance graph
Collaboration diagram for Layer::AddMeasurementRectCommand:
Collaboration graph

Public Member Functions

 AddMeasurementRectCommand (Layer *layer, MeasureRect rect)
 
QString getName () const override
 
void execute () override
 
void unexecute () override
 

Private Attributes

Layerm_layer
 
MeasureRect m_rect
 

Detailed Description

Definition at line 652 of file Layer.h.

Constructor & Destructor Documentation

Layer::AddMeasurementRectCommand::AddMeasurementRectCommand ( Layer layer,
MeasureRect  rect 
)
inline

Definition at line 655 of file Layer.h.

Member Function Documentation

QString Layer::AddMeasurementRectCommand::getName ( ) const
override

Definition at line 354 of file Layer.cpp.

void Layer::AddMeasurementRectCommand::execute ( )
override

Definition at line 360 of file Layer.cpp.

void Layer::AddMeasurementRectCommand::unexecute ( )
override

Definition at line 366 of file Layer.cpp.

Member Data Documentation

Layer* Layer::AddMeasurementRectCommand::m_layer
private

Definition at line 663 of file Layer.h.

MeasureRect Layer::AddMeasurementRectCommand::m_rect
private

Definition at line 664 of file Layer.h.


The documentation for this class was generated from the following files: